Transaction 299ce802dec61586d68ca79fed2ef50b2477893722a9bf31f184ddd4ebc2ed49

1 Input
2 Outputs
  • 299ce802dec61586d68ca79fed2ef50b2477893722a9bf31f184ddd4ebc2ed49:0
  • value  73000000
    address  31ydqDVdzfXjd7PLypS2U2FCoLvoxjtmEn
  • 299ce802dec61586d68ca79fed2ef50b2477893722a9bf31f184ddd4ebc2ed49:1
  • value  141035526
    address  1Lvv6SfsR6ThuCiWQU8bozWqjqeq2oaSPc